VAMP2 Antibodies
VAMP2 is a presynaptic SNARE protein essential for synaptic vesicle fusion and neurotransmitter release. CSF VAMP2 levels reflect (pre)synaptic degeneration and are altered across the Alzheimer’s disease continuum, showing correlations with core AD biomarkers and cognitive impairment, thereby supporting its interpretation as a marker of presynaptic/synaptic degeneration1,2. VAMP2 may also interact with α‑synuclein biology and synaptic vulnerability. Plasma VAMP2 findings are emerging, with some recent studies suggesting moderate correlations with other synaptic markers and synaptic-density PET or cognition in older adults, suggesting blood VAMP2 may carry a central synaptic signal, but results remain mixed3.
The ADx413 and ADx414 monoclonal antibodies targeting VAMP2 can support the development of immunoassays able to quantify this synaptic protein in different biofluids.
